Excel Datei in Dictionary unwandeln Python?
Wie wandelt man eine Excel Datei in ein Dictionary um. Ich habe mit import Pandas as pd eine Excel Datei importiert, nun möchte ich dies in ein Dictionary um wandeln. Wie bekomme ich das hin mit dem Befehl df.to_dict()? Am besten mit unkomplizierten Befehlen..
Mein Ansatz bis jetzt:
import pandas as pd
Tabelle=pd.read_excel("Tabelle.xlsx")
......
1 Antwort
Die read_excel-Methode liefert ein DataFrame-Objekt. Das wiederum kennt eine to_dict-Methode.
Die notwendigen Methoden stehen in meiner Antwort.
Beispiel:
import pandas as pd
tabelle = pd.read_excel("Tabelle.xlsx")
daten = tabelle.to_dict()
Vergleiche deinen dazugehörigen Codeabschnitt mit dem von mir. Bis auf die Namen von Variablen sollte es da ja keine großen Unterschiede geben.
Der nächste Schritt wäre, genau zu prüfen, was denn nun quer läuft.
- Vielleicht gibt es eine Fehlermeldung, dann ist auch deren Wortlaut von Interesse. Im besten Fall verweist sie auf eine bestimmte Codezeile, denn dann ist klar, wo gesucht werden muss.
- Vielleicht erlebst du ein unerwartetes Verhalten. Das sollte aber erst einmal genauer beschrieben werden.
Hilfestellung gebe ich nur hier auf der öffentlichen Plattform.
Welchen Befehl muss ich dann benutzen?...